ADAPTIVE RATE 400G
ECI Proprietary 6
Adapts rate to distance and line conditions
800Km400G
2 x 200GDP-16QAM
1200Km300G
2 x 150GDP-8QAM
4000Km200G
2 x 100GDP-QPSK

OPTICAL MONITORING COMPLEXITY
16
Real OSNR
Wrong OSNR
IN-band OSNR
Out-of-band OSNR
ROADMs cause noise shaping and over estimation of OSNR
Coherent 100G & 200G signals are closely spaced and overlap causing under estimation of OSNR
Wrong OSNR
